3. Description and Purpose (≈1–2 paragraphs, 150–200 words)

  • Describe the test format (true/false self-report questionnaire).

  • MMPI-2: 567 items, revised version of the MMPI, used for adults.

  • Purpose: assess personality structure and psychopathology, often in clinical, forensic, and occupational settings.

  • MMPI-A: shorter, adolescent version with 478 items, designed for 14–18 years old.

  • Note updates and improvements over time (validity scales, cultural adaptations).


4. Population (≈1 paragraph, 100–150 words)

  • MMPI-2: adults 18+ in clinical or counseling contexts.

  • MMPI-A: adolescents (14–18), for evaluation of behavioral, emotional, and social functioning.

  • Both: widely used across mental health, medical, forensic, and correctional settings.


5. Results Provided (≈1–2 paragraphs, 150–200 words)

  • Explain scoring: clinical scales, validity scales, content scales.

  • Highlight that results identify personality features, symptom patterns, and possible psychopathology.

  • Example: elevated scores on Scale 2 (Depression) suggest depressive symptoms; high F scale may suggest symptom exaggeration or distress.


6. Interpretations (≈1–2 paragraphs, 150–200 words)

  • Discuss what clinicians can conclude (diagnostic impressions, treatment planning, forensic evaluations).

  • Strengths: strong empirical base, validity checks, wide use, standardization.

  • Limitations: length of the test, cultural/linguistic biases, overpathologizing normal behavior, reliance on self-report.

  • Mention that results must be interpreted by trained professionals.
